Big Black Rocks for Landscaping A Trend with Impact
In recent years, the use of big black rocks in landscaping has gained significant popularity among homeowners and landscape architects alike. These striking stones, with their dark hues and bold presence, provide a unique aesthetic that can transform any outdoor space into a visually stunning environment. This article explores the benefits, aesthetics, and practical applications of incorporating big black rocks into your landscaping design.

In terms of durability, big black rocks are a practical choice for landscaping. Unlike traditional soil or mulch, which can erode or require frequent replenishing, rocks are virtually maintenance-free. They do not fade or decompose, ensuring that your landscape remains consistently stylish without the need for regular upkeep. Moreover, using rocks can significantly reduce water evaporation in planted areas, as they help retain moisture in the soil, making them an eco-friendly choice for those looking to conserve water.
From a functionality standpoint, big black rocks can be used in various landscaping applications. They are ideal for creating pathways, defining borders, or even enhancing water features such as ponds and streams. Large stones placed strategically can create natural seating areas or serve as resilient bases for fire pits. Their versatility makes them suitable for both modern and traditional styles, allowing them to fit seamlessly within a variety of design aesthetics.
In addition to their aesthetic and practical benefits, big black rocks also represent an environmentally conscious choice. They are a natural resource that does not introduce harmful chemicals into the ecosystem, making them an excellent option for environmentally-minded homeowners. Using locally sourced rocks reduces the carbon footprint associated with transporting materials, contributing to a more sustainable landscape design.
In conclusion, big black rocks are a powerful tool for any landscaper or gardening enthusiast. Their striking appearance, durability, and versatility make them an excellent choice for enhancing outdoor spaces. By incorporating these dramatic stones into your landscaping design, you can create a beautiful, low-maintenance, and environmentally friendly environment that will stand the test of time.
